Quick Glance: Archbishop of Canterbury Addresses Kate Middleton's Cancer Battle in Easter Sermon
- During his Easter Sunday sermon, Archbishop of Canterbury Justin Welby discussed the struggles of King Charles and Kate Middleton, the Princess of Wales, as they battle cancer.
- Both royals chose to share their cancer diagnoses publicly to support others facing similar challenges.
- King Charles revealed his cancer diagnosis after a treatment for an enlarged prostate, while Princess Kate announced she is undergoing preventative chemotherapy.
- Archbishop Welby condemned conspiracy theories surrounding Kate's absence, emphasizing the need for privacy and compassion during difficult times.

Quick Glance: Families' Anger as Triple Killer Receives Hospital Order
- Barnaby Webber and Grace O'Malley-Kumar, both 19, were fatally stabbed on June 13 along with Ian Coates, 65.
- The killer will be detained at a high-security hospital after admitting manslaughter on the grounds of diminished responsibility.
- Mr Webber's mother said 'true justice has not been served'.
- The victims' families voiced their anger at the outcome in front of Nottingham Crown Court.
